How to read this number

Read alongside breed popularity, veterinary access, and owner awareness, these shape how many events ever reach the FDA. The comparison line marks the cross-breed median death-coded share (about 4.8%) among breeds with 50 or more reports; values above it suggest higher reporting bias toward severe outcomes, not necessarily higher true mortality.

Does a high number of adverse event reports mean Basset - Fawn Brittany is unhealthy?
No. FDA adverse event reports are voluntarily submitted and do not prove causation. Popular breeds with more veterinary visits tend to have more reports. The data reflects reporting patterns, not actual incidence rates. Always consult a veterinarian for health decisions.
Where does this Basset - Fawn Brittany safety data come from?
All data comes from the FDA Center for Veterinary Medicine's adverse event reporting system. Pet owners, veterinarians, and manufacturers voluntarily submit reports about adverse events potentially linked to animal drugs and other products.
